Experts from the Fraunhofer IAPT will present the current state of artificial intelligence, machine vision, and learning systems for cost-effective quality assurance in additive manufacturing during an online session on October 16, 2025.
Hamburg-Bergedorf, September 17, 2025. The Fraunhofer IAPT is researching the industrial application of additive manufacturing. The perspective across the entire additive process chain considers both the economic viability and the quality of components. The virtualization of all production phases provides a particularly effective lever. It connects previously fragmented data, addresses scaling challenges, and automates manual processes.
Online Session on the Application and Economics of AI in Quality Assurance
On October 16, 2025, experts from the Fraunhofer IAPT will showcase research findings from the field of virtualization in an online session. The session will illustrate the benefits of digital twins, artificial intelligence (AI), and learning systems for additive manufacturing through selected application areas. Specific use cases will demonstrate how AI paves the way for new approaches to quality assurance.
The focus is on accelerating and automating quality management, for example through shop-floor solutions for production and operations managers, as well as QA and inspection teams. A case study from the industry will also highlight the cost-effectiveness of AI solutions in additive manufacturing.

About Fraunhofer IAPT
The Fraunhofer IAPT stands for sustainable innovations in the field of additive manufac-turing. Its portfolio includes research and development along the entire AM manufactur-ing route – from unique component designs and system solutions, including process and material levels, to factory planning and virtualization. All aspects of the additive manu-facturing process are comprehensively considered from the initial idea and feasibility to industrial implementation in new or existing production environments. A particular focus is placed on socially relevant future topics in the fields of life sciences, energy, mobility, as well as security and defense. Our overarching goal is to ensure that additive manufac-turing technologies are industrially applied, significantly contributing to increased produc-tivity, resource conservation, resilience, and prosperity.
